
To mark the July 28, World Day Against Viral Hepatitis, and strengthen the need for people to seek diagnosis and prevention of these diseases. The World Health Organization, launches the theme of the Hepatitis 2018 campaign. “Hepatitis, it’s time to diagnose, treat and cure.” Activities under this theme can help achieve the following country-specific and global objectives
- (a) support the expansion of hepatitis prevention, testing, treatment and care services, with a specific focus on promoting WHO recommendations for testing and treatment;
- b) show best practices and promote universal health coverage of hepatitis care services;
- (c) improving partnerships and funding in the fight against viral hepatitis.Timely testing and treatment of viral hepatitis B and C can save lives.To find documents on the subject go to the WHO website
